Designed for agricultural stem mechanics
The Hongwei HW-JG2B is a specialist crop stalk strength tester built for crop science teams that need precise, defensible force data from real plant samples. Rather than forcing a generic gauge into an agronomy workflow, this instrument is positioned specifically for stem bending, compression and puncture-style assessments in cereals and other stalked plants.
Why 50N is the right range for crop work
Its controlled 50N capacity is well suited to delicate-to-moderate stems where sensitivity matters more than heavy-load capability. That makes it a strong fit as a wheat stem strength tester, rice stem strength tester and general plant compression strength tester for lodging-resistance studies, variety trials, breeding selection and plant biomechanics research.
Repeatability with a dedicated test stand
The included 50N force gauge test stand helps improve alignment, stroke control and sample consistency across repeated measurements. For UK laboratories and field-trial teams, that means cleaner comparison data between plots, cultivars and treatment groups than is typically achievable with hand-held generic force gauges.

Technical Specifications
- Force Capacity
- 0-50 N
- Resolution
- 0.01 N
- Accuracy
- ±0.5% FS
- Test Modes
- Bending, compression, puncture
- Power Supply
- 220V AC adaptor / rechargeable battery pack
- Certification
- CE marked; calibration traceability supplied
- Instrument Weight
- 4.8 kg
- Overall Dimensions
- 420 × 220 × 520 mm
- Warranty
- 2 Years UK
